BET: Army -7.5

One of the best parts about this matchup, setting aside the final score, is how close it tends to be. That makes sense, since it’s hard to pull away when there’s only 30 total points being put up, but everyone likes an exciting finish no matter how we get there. Unfortunately, I don’t see it here. This Army team has been impressive all season, beating solid teams like Western Michigan and Liberty while putting up a fight against Wake Forest and Wisconsin. Their success has come primarily from their ability to score points despite relying exclusively on their run game for yards, and the 35.5 PPG average tells that story pretty clearly.

Navy, on the other hand, just aren’t quite ready to compete against their rivals. This team has only won 3 games and Lavatai, their first year starting QB, has hamstrung them a bit when running the triple option by making poor decisions. More importantly, Navy’s run defense just isn’t particularly great either. They gave up over 130 yards per game on the year against teams who don’t exclusively run the ball, and against Army that number could get high pretty quick unless they step up their play and close out running lanes more effectively. The line, which is -7.5 for the Black Nights, feels extremely high when the total is just 34.5, but Army is the far better team and knows how to win football games.
